What is Le Belier PEG Ratio?

PE Ratio without NRI / 5-Year EBITDA Growth Rate*

PEG Ratio is defined as the PE Ratio without NRI divided by the growth ratio. The growth rate we use is the 5-Year EBITDA growth rate. As of today, Le Belier's PE Ratio without NRI is 60.32. Le Belier's 5-Year EBITDA growth rate is 0.00%. Therefore, Le Belier's PEG Ratio for today is N/A.

* The 5-Year EBITDA Growth Rate is the 5-year average EBITDA per share growth rate. While the denominator is a percentage, we use the whole number as opposed to the decimal form for the calculation. For example, 5% would be shown as 5 as opposed to 0.05. If it's smaller than or equal to 0, then the PEG Ratio is not calculated.

Le Belier  (XPAR:BELI) PEG Ratio Explanation

To compare stocks with different growth rates, Peter Lynch invented a ratio called PEG Ratio. PEG Ratio is defined as the P/E ratio divided by the growth ratio. He thinks a company with a P/E ratio equal to its growth rate is fairly valued. Still he said he would rather buy a company growing 20% a year with a P/E of 20, instead of a company growing 10% a year with a P/E of 10.

Le Belier SA is a France-based company engaged in manufacturing of aluminum safety-related parts for the automotive industry. It operates through three segments: Foundry services, Machining and Tool-making. The Foundry services cover the transformation of casting a liquid metal into a mold to reproduce specific parts, while the Machining division produces high precision mechanical parts with tolerances in microns and the Tool-making division designs and produces foundry tools. It offers products such as braking systems, turbo systems, suspension and chassis parts which are sold to auto component suppliers such as Delphi, Bosch, Valio and others.
